PlayStation Plus Premium subscribers get the most out of their memberships. Costing $17.99 per month, the subscription give access to tons of benefits that PlayStation players will surely use. This includes the ability to cloud stream games on PS5. The platform’s cloud streaming library continues to grow every month, with last February seeing a staggering amount of games available to stream with the service.
Sony added 371 titles to PlayStation’s cloud streaming library
According to Cloud Dosage, it runs a script every week that searches for new cloud games. Its data showed that Sony added 371 titles to PlayStation’s cloud streaming library. This means there is now over 1800 titles available to purchase that can take advantage of the technology.
It is important to note that this large number of items playable through PlayStation’s cloud streaming feature may include demos or trials for PS5 and PS4 games. Regardless, there is still a massive amount of games available to stream with the service.
For this current smattering of cloud streaming additions, it features some tremendously popular games for PS5, some of which released within the last year. This includes Helldivers 2, Like a Dragon: Pirate Yakuza in Hawaii, Warhammer 40K: Space Marine 2, and Silent Hill 2. It should be noted that these games are only playable on PS5 consoles. Also, as mentioned above, cloud streaming games is only a benefit for PS Plus Premium subscribers. This means Essential and Extra members do not have access to this feature, and will have to upgrade their membership if they wish to use it.
As mentioned above, PS Plus Premium memberships start at $17.99 a month. Players interested in more than just a month can get a bit of a discount if they decide they want the membership for a longer period of time. A three month subscription costs $49.99, while a 12 month subscription costs $159.99.
